Jul. 6th, 2011 09:14 am"Ephemerata Speculata," or EphSpec, is an ephemeral, time-based event
whose purpose is to allow writers of speculative fiction to share
their work with the public, and to provide an opportunity for
community with other writers and readers of the genre. The inaugural
EphSpec event will be held at 5:00 pm on Sunday, July 17, 2011 at
Tabor Space, 5441 SE Belmont, Portland, Oregon (corner of 55th and SE Belmont). Come
hear writers Bob Zahniser, David D. Levine, David W. Goldman, and
Jennifer Cox read their work! For more information, see
